Audio: The Story Of The Man Who Hustled Hitler

Walter Shapiro, author of "Hustling Hitler: The Jewish Vaudevillian Who Fooled the Führer", tells the story of how his great-uncle Freeman Bernstein managed to cheat Adolf Hitler and the Nazi government.
